Introducing Steve Howard, our new teacher of Physics.


My name is Steve Howard and I am a Physics and Maths teacher with more than 20 years' experience working in education. I have worked in comprehensive secondary schools, a new studio school and a specialist post-16 college, and have held a number of school leadership positions across the South West of England.

Throughout my career I have focused on driving strong academic progress and outcomes for all students, ensuring every young person is supported and stretched to achieve their full potential.

I have a particular strength and passion for Teaching and Learning, ensuring the school and my classroom is inclusive for all students, and I have worked for many years developing learning environments which work for neurodiverse students.

Before becoming a teacher I was an engineer working in high volume automotive manufacturing, but this was nowhere near as much fun as working as a teacher. Prior to that I worked in medical engineering, for which I was awarded a PhD for my part in developing a training aid for shoulder dystocia, a medical emergency occurring during labour.

I am married and have two school age children who bring me much joy and excitement. I enjoy a busy family life sharing in our love of the natural world. I particularly love cycling in all its forms, walking, wild camping, swimming in our plethora of beautiful swimming spots, sea kayaking and playing music. I am a singer, songwriter and guitarist who loves to perform on the local 'circuit'.

Congratulations to Adam who is today celebrating his excellent set of GCSE results including a 9 in Computing which is well deserved and reflective of his passion for coding and AI.

Adam shared this with us about his summer:

“This summer, I was accepted on to the International Programme at Downing College. University of Cambridge.

One of the highlights was the academic sessions in Maths and Biology. In Biology, we even had the chance to test our own blood to identify our blood groups, which made the experience much more practical and memorable. In Engineering, we learnt how to code robots and put our programming skills into practice, which was particularly exciting as we could immediately see the results of what we had created. We were also encouraged to discuss and challenge ideas rather than simply accept them, which I really enjoyed. In some sessions, we had to debate topics with professors, defend our opinions and consider arguments from different perspectives. This really helped me become more confident in expressing my ideas and thinking critically.

Towards the end of the programme, we had a final assignment where we had to explore a topic, my topic was

“Is synergy between humans and AI the path for humanity, rather than the replacement?”

I had to argue both sides of the issue and present our conclusions as a vlog to the entire cohort. I really enjoyed this because it combined research, discussion and creativity, while also challenging us to look at an issue from more than one point of view.

Experiencing the academic and social side of university life first-hand showed me how much there is to explore and achieve. Although I wish the programme had lasted longer, I came away with new experiences, new friendships and a much stronger motivation to work towards university. This builds on my time at Trinity which has given me so many opportunities to experience and explore the bigger topics in life.”

Congratulations Adam on taking all these positive steps to achieving your future goals.

We’re extremely proud of our GCSE students and are pleased to see success across our cohort no matter how long they have been with us demonstrating how inclusive we are as a school. With 14% of 7-9 grades and 68% with 9-4 we are proud of the individual student progress we have seen.

We’re so pleased to have so many students who have achieved the results to return to our Sixth Form in September and we can’t wait to welcome you. Our Year 12 cohort is growing by 300% and our school overall by 25% so we are thrilled so many of our Year 11 are continuing with us.
Whether you’re staying on with us or moving on to somewhere new, well done and we wish you all the very best.

Student and subject highlights:

💯100% pass rate in Performing Arts, English as Second Language, History and RE, Turkish, Persian, Further Maths, Art and Spanish

💻Adam Moore is celebrating his level 9 in Computer Science having spent some of the summer at the University of Cambridge contributing and speaking at an AI programme.

🎉Elena Cabezali is celebrated a clutch of top grades including a Grade 9 in English after arriving in England last September.

🇪🇸Oscar Olley-Wilder is also celebrating fantastic results ready to continue his studies and his passion for history and Spanish at A Level at Trinity

🎭 All Year 11 students received a Distinction * in Performing Arts

♾️Dexter Jeffery who has just completed Year 10 is celebrating a grade 9 in Mathematics.

Introducing our new teacher of Maths and Economics.

Adam has spent over 25 years working in schools across the UK, the Middle East, and Asia, including three Headships at Wellington Prep School in Somerset, Cranleigh Abu Dhabi, and most recently as Founding Principal of Dulwich College Bangkok.

A mathematician at heart, Adam began his career as a Maths Curriculum Leader, and maths has remained a constant thread. He holds a PGCE from Loughborough University, a Certificate in Mathematical Education from Cambridge University and a BSc in Economics from Southampton.

He has written materials for the Department for Education and contributed to many education publications. He has also been regularly deployed as an ISI inspector.

Beyond school, Adam is a keen cyclist and runner, having completed a full ironman distance triathlon and represented Great Britain as an age group athlete.
